Amey signs £35m consultancy services contract with Department for Infrastructure (DfI) Transport and Road Asset Management (TRAM)

Amey has been awarded a new £35m contract with the Department for Infrastructure (DfI) Transport and Road Asset Management (TRAM) to deliver a wide range of civil engineering consultancy services. The contract, running for three years with an option to extend for another two, will involve delivering major and minor highway improvements, active travel schemes, and more sustainable transport infrastructure across the region.
